You do realize that to every rule (I'm assuming you were talking about the rule of thirds?) there are exceptions, right? I think this is a good example.

The key to being a good photographer isn't simply knowing all the "rules", but understanding them to the point of knowing why they will make a given photo appealing. And with that knowledge, that level of understanding, comes the ability of knowing when you can break them.
